N-(trans-4-Isopropylcyclohexylcarbonyl)-D-phenylalanine (A4166) is a new oral antidiabetic agent. In order to determine the purity of chemical samples of A4166, a high-performance liquid chromatographic method for the separation of A4166 and synthetic by-products (an L-enantiomer and acis-iosmer of A4166) has been developed. A chiral stationary phase column packed with 5 μm N-(tert-butylaminocarbonyl)-L-valylaminopropyl silica gel was used for the direct separation of A4166 and its isomers after derivatization with a non-chiral reagent.
